The situation this course is for

Even with strong technical controls, organizations fail to see how cultural blind spots, reporting gaps, and misaligned incentives erode OT security. Traditional frameworks don’t address the behavioral and organizational dynamics that determine real-world outcomes. This leads to underreporting, delayed response, and recurring incidents that appear preventable in hindsight.
